Does baby powder dry out the skin?
Baby powder can potentially dry out the skin if used excessively or if the skin is already prone to dryness. The main ingredient in baby powder, typically talcum powder or cornstarch, can absorb moisture from the skin, which may lead to dryness. It is important to use baby powder in moderation and consider other alternatives if you have dry or sensitive skin.

How does baby powder dry out hair?
Baby powder contains ingredients like talc or cornstarch that help absorb excess oil and moisture from the hair. When applied to the scalp and roots, baby powder helps to soak up any oils present, leaving the hair looking less greasy and more voluminous. This absorption process can also help to dry out the hair by reducing the amount of moisture present, making it a popular option for those looking to extend the time between hair washes.

Can baby powder be used as dry shampoo?
While some people may use baby powder as a dry shampoo alternative, it is not recommended. Baby powder can leave a white residue in the hair and may not effectively absorb excess oil. Additionally, some baby powders contain talc, which has been linked to health concerns when inhaled. It is best to use products specifically designed for dry shampoo to ensure effectiveness and safety.

What is the difference between dry yeast and baking powder?
Dry yeast is a living organism that needs to be activated by warm water and sugar before being added to dough to help it rise. On the other hand, baking powder is a chemical leavening agent that contains both an acid and a base, which react when mixed with liquid to produce carbon dioxide gas, causing the dough to rise. Dry yeast is typically used in recipes that require longer rising times, like bread, while baking powder is used in recipes that need a quick rise, such as cakes and muffins.

Is powder too oily or too dry for combination skin?
Powder can be a good option for combination skin as it helps to control excess oil in the T-zone while providing a matte finish. However, it is important to choose a powder that is not too drying, as this can exacerbate dry patches on the skin. Look for a finely milled powder that is oil-free and provides a natural finish to avoid making the skin look too oily or too dry.

Why does baking powder need to be stored in a dry place?
Baking powder needs to be stored in a dry place because it is a chemical leavening agent that reacts with moisture. When exposed to moisture, baking powder can lose its effectiveness and potency. Storing it in a dry place helps to prevent clumping and ensures that it remains active for baking purposes. Moisture can also cause the baking powder to react prematurely, leading to uneven rising and texture in baked goods.

Which powder is suitable for very fair skin and does not dry it out?
A translucent or light-colored setting powder would be suitable for very fair skin as it will not alter the skin tone. Look for powders that are finely milled and have hydrating or moisturizing properties to prevent drying out the skin. Mineral powders or powders with added ingredients like hyaluronic acid or vitamin E can help keep very fair skin looking fresh and hydrated.
